NEW ZEAMD RAILWAYS. WELLINGTON SECTION. PUBLIC attention is directed to the alterations to take effect from anQ including July Ist proximo, aa under • Trains will discontinue to atop at the Flag Stations known as Wallacevilleand Middleion. Train's which have occasionally stopped at Waterson's line and Armstrong's siding on Saturdays will not any longer stop at those Traffic Agent's Office, Wellington, I jrd June, 1891.
